Context: The Protocol Mechanics of the Geran-2

To understand the threat, you must first audit the node. The Geran-2 is a derivative of the Iranian Shahed-136, a 'loitering munition' or 'one-way attack UAV' (OWA-UAV). Technically, it is a low-cost, long-range, single-use asset. Think of it as a high-volume, low-value transaction in a blockchain: its power lies not in its individual complexity, but in its ability to flood the mempool.

  • Payload: ~40-50 kg of high explosive. A delicate balance of destructive potential and flight efficiency.
  • Cruise Speed: ~180 km/h. Slow by modern jet standards, but persistent and difficult to intercept at scale.
  • Navigation: A multi-layered consensus mechanism. Primary: GLONASS/GPS satellite navigation. Fallback: Inertial navigation. Final approach: A visual/infrared correlation or a cellular network (SIM card) signal for terminal guidance. This is a Byzantine fault-tolerant system, but with a weak finality layer.
  • Cost: An estimated $20,000 - $50,000 per unit. This is the gas fee for a state-changing attack.

The operational model is a textbook 'spam attack'. You don't need each transaction to be valid; you just need to overwhelm the validator (the Ukrainian air defense system). The cost of a single 'valid' intercept (a Patriot missile costing $2-4 million) is 100x the cost of the 'invalid' transaction (the Geran). This is a classic economic attack vector. The exchange rate is brutal.

Core: The Code-Level Analysis of the Supply Chain

The claim of 3,000 units/month is a throughput claim. Let's analyze the infrastructure required to maintain this block time.

Based on open-source intelligence (OSINT) and the principles of industrial cryptography, we can break down the supply chain into three critical layers:

  1. The Execution Layer (The Production Line): The production facility is likely the Alabuga Special Economic Zone, a sprawling industrial complex. This is the 'validator' producing the blocks. A throughput of 3,000 units/month implies a block time of roughly one drone every 14 minutes, assuming a 24/7 operation. This is a significant engineering feat, but not impossible. Russia has shifted its economy to a 'war footing', allocating a massive share of GDP (over 8% in 2025-2026, per reports) to defense. This is a state-level sequencer.
  1. The Data Availability Layer (The Component Supply): Here is the critical vulnerability. The Geran-2 is not built from exotic, military-grade components. It is a Frankenstein's monster of civilian-grade electronics. Ukrainian post-mortems of downed drones have revealed chips from STMicroelectronics, Texas Instruments, and other Western firms. This is the 'data availability' problem. The security of the entire system depends on the continuous flow of these components. Russia's ability to maintain this throughput is contingent on a 'shadow data availability layer'—a network of intermediaries, shell companies, and transshipment points through Turkey, the UAE, Central Asia, and China.
  1. The Consensus Mechanism (The Strategic Logic): The production run is not a one-off airdrop; it is a sustained emission schedule. The logic is to create a persistent, economically draining denial-of-service attack. The goal is to force Ukraine and its Western backers to continuously expend more resources (capital, political will, missile stockpiles) on defense than Russia expends on offense. This is a Sybil attack on a national scale, where the cost of creating a new identity (a drone) is far lower than the cost of verifying it (shooting it down).

Contrarian: The Blind Spots in the Attack Vector

The conventional narrative is that this massive drone production is an insurmountable threat. But a systems-level analysis reveals two critical blind spots that could flip the script.

First, the vulnerability of the guidance system. The Geran-2's reliance on a multi-layered guidance system is its greatest strength but also its greatest weakness. The integration of a SIM card for terminal guidance, using Ukraine's own cellular network, is a feature, not a bug. However, it introduces a massive attack surface. If Ukraine's cyber warfare units can inject false signals into the guidance system, or if they can jam the GPS/GLONASS signals effectively enough to force the drone into blind navigation, the entire 'spam attack' loses its efficacy. The 'exchange rate' flips. A low-cost jammer or signal spoofing device is far cheaper than a Patriot missile. Code does not lie, but it often omits the truth: the Geran's intelligence is a fragile, borrowed intelligence.

Second, the 'mining difficulty' of the supply chain. The Western sanctions regime is not designed to be a perfect firewall. It is designed to be a 'cost penalty'. As my 2023 benchmark of ZK-rollups showed, the initial setup cost of a ZK system is higher, but it offers better long-term stability. For Russia, the setup cost of a shadow supply chain is immense. It requires a complex network of money laundering, shell companies, and data obfuscation. This adds a 30-100% premium to the cost of each component. The 3,000 units/month number is a point estimate. The cost curve is steep. If the West increases its secondary sanctions enforcement on the transshipment hubs, the 'block reward' for Russia's production line will become too low to sustain the operation. The economic attack vector is a two-way street.
